B Frangione is a scholar working on Molecular Biology, Physiology and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, B Frangione has authored 52 papers receiving a total of 3.8k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Molecular Biology, 23 papers in Physiology and 7 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in B Frangione’s work include Alzheimer's disease research and treatments (21 papers), Amyloidosis: Diagnosis, Treatment, Outcomes (17 papers) and Prion Diseases and Protein Misfolding (11 papers). B Frangione is often cited by papers focused on Alzheimer's disease research and treatments (21 papers), Amyloidosis: Diagnosis, Treatment, Outcomes (17 papers) and Prion Diseases and Protein Misfolding (11 papers). B Frangione collaborates with scholars based in United States, Italy and United Kingdom. B Frangione's co-authors include Frances Prelli, Jorge Ghiso, Tobun T. Cheung, Todd E. Golde, Steven G. Younkin, Steven Estus, Lillian M. Shaffer, Ron Tintner, Mikio Shoji and E. C. Franklin and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.
